I really can't fathom why this place is rated so highly. The food managed that delicate combination of being completely lackluster and embarrassingly overpriced. My wife ordered the paella and it was flavorless and texture was reminiscent of the days when, as a child, i attempted to cook rice in the microwave. Mushy would have been an understatement. I've eaten mashed potatoes with more texture than whatever came out of the pan and was passed off as paella that day. I ordered the Barrio Burger thinking, "it contains the name of the restaurant we're in! There's no way this can suck!" But suck, it did. The waiter confirmed that I wanted medium rare but then served a completely overdone hockey puck of a patty that tasted as though they'd lopped off a piece of burnt juniper from a fire ring at Tumalo State Park and served tat instead. On the bright side, the wait staff really was nice and attentive. I feel bad that they have to serve such low quality food at premium prices.
